How This Trend Is Shaping the Future of Urban Air Mobility

The GoAero Prize and its focus on emergency response flyers directly influence the development of UAM in several key ways. First, it accelerates technological development by incentivizing innovation. Teams are driven to create more efficient, reliable, and safe eVTOL designs to meet the stringent requirements of the competition.

Second, it expands the potential use cases for eVTOL aircraft. By demonstrating their effectiveness in emergency situations, such as search and rescue, disaster relief, and medical transport, the competition broadens the perceived value of these aircraft. This increased value proposition attracts a wider range of investors and stakeholders.

Third, it fosters public acceptance. Seeing eVTOLs used for humanitarian purposes can significantly improve public perception and allay fears about safety and noise pollution. This is essential for paving the way for the widespread adoption of UAM in urban environments.

Key Risks, Timelines, and What Serious Investors Should Watch

Investing in the eVTOL market, and particularly in deep-tech startups like HPS Aviation, carries inherent risks. Regulatory hurdles, technological challenges, and market competition are all factors that investors need to carefully consider. The certification process for eVTOL aircraft is complex and lengthy, and delays can significantly impact timelines and profitability.

Technological risks include the development and validation of new propulsion systems, the integration of advanced sensors and control systems, and the achievement of required safety standards. Market risks include the adoption rate of UAM, the availability of infrastructure, and the emergence of competing technologies.
